Understanding Sound Absorption and Acoustic Principles
Sound travels through air in waves that bounce off hard surfaces, creating reflections that accumulate into unwanted noise. Soft, porous materials like rugs interrupt this acoustic cycle by absorbing sound energy and converting it into heat, effectively dampening the reflective properties of your room.
- Sound Wave Absorption: When sound waves encounter a rug's textile fibers, the waves lose energy as they move through the material's structure. The more dense and textured the rug, the greater the sound absorption capability. Peach rugs made from thicker pile heights or wool blends demonstrate superior absorption compared to thin, tightly woven alternatives.
- Frequency-Dependent Absorption: Different materials absorb different sound frequencies effectively. Rugs excel at absorbing mid-to-high frequency sounds (like voices and machinery) while being less effective at very low-frequency bass tones. Layering rugs or combining them with padding enhances absorption across a broader frequency spectrum.
- Acoustic Reverberation Reduction: Empty rooms with hard surfaces create "RT60" measurements—the time it takes for sound to decay by 60 decibels. A peach rug can reduce this reverberation time significantly, making spaces feel warmer and more intimate while improving speech clarity.
Fabric Properties That Enhance Acoustic Performance
Not all rugs perform equally for sound absorption. Understanding which materials and construction methods optimize acoustic benefits helps you choose peach rugs that serve both aesthetic and functional purposes.
- Pile Height and Density: Thick, dense piles trap sound waves more effectively than thin, tightly woven surfaces. Plush peach rugs with pile heights of 0.75 inches or greater provide noticeably better sound absorption than low-pile alternatives. The air pockets within the pile structure create an ideal environment for sound energy dissipation.
- Natural Fiber Advantages: Wool, jute, and other natural fibers possess inherent sound-absorbing properties superior to synthetic materials. Wool rugs, in particular, have crimped fiber structures that create micro-spaces ideal for sound trapping. If acoustic performance matters in your space, consider peach wool rugs or wool-blend options.
- Backing Material Impact: The backing beneath a rug influences its acoustic properties. Felt or rubber backings enhance sound absorption compared to non-padded alternatives. Quality rug pads positioned beneath peach rugs further improve acoustic performance while protecting floors.
- Underlay and Padding: Adding acoustic rug pads beneath your peach rug dramatically increases sound absorption capability. High-density foam or rubber underlays work synergistically with the rug's fibers to create a multi-layer acoustic barrier that rivals professional soundproofing solutions.

Measuring and Assessing Acoustic Performance
Understanding how to evaluate acoustic improvements helps you choose peach rugs and placement strategies most beneficial for your specific situation.
- Qualitative Assessment Methods: Before investing in professional measurements, perform simple listening tests. Clap your hands in a room with and without a peach rug and notice echo reduction, walk across floor surfaces with and without coverage, and observe how conversations sound at different volumes. These subjective tests reveal practical acoustic changes.
- Noise Level Measurements: Using smartphone decibel meter apps provides rough estimates of sound level changes. While not laboratory-grade accurate, these apps offer reasonable comparisons showing noise reduction from rug placement across different scenarios.
- Professional Acoustic Analysis: For critical spaces like home studios or media rooms, professional acoustic testing using RT60 measurements and frequency analysis provides detailed data about acoustic improvements and identifies remaining problem areas requiring additional treatment.
- Practical Observation Metrics: Track whether conversations seem clearer, if television audio seems more balanced, if sleep quality improves, and if background noise from adjacent rooms diminishes. These practical improvements often matter more than technical measurements.
Maintaining Acoustic Performance Over Time
Protecting your peach rug's acoustic properties requires maintenance practices that preserve fiber structure and density.
- Regular Vacuuming: Dust and debris accumulation reduces fiber effectiveness for sound absorption. Regular vacuuming maintains fiber structure and preserves acoustic performance. Use gentle techniques that don't compress pile height unnecessarily.
- Professional Cleaning: Periodic professional cleaning removes deep dirt that compromises fiber space and sound absorption capability. Annual or biennial professional cleaning maintains optimal acoustic performance while extending overall rug lifespan.
- Avoiding Rug Flattening: Heavy furniture placement without rug pads causes flattening that reduces pile height and acoustic effectiveness. Rotate furniture periodically and use furniture pads to distribute weight and maintain fiber structure essential for sound absorption.
- Humidity Control: Dry environments can make fibers brittle and less effective for acoustic purposes. Maintaining moderate humidity levels (30-50%) preserves fiber elasticity and optimal sound-absorbing properties of your peach rug.
